The term lame duck refers to

a. a chief executive representing a party other than the one in the majority in the legislature.
b. an ineffective chief executive.
c. a chief executive being investigated by the court or by the legislature for wrongdoing in office.
d. a chief executive in the last months of his or her final term in office.


Answer: d
